Help Build A Water System in Haiti

Due to the highly dangerous contamination of rivers that many Haitians rely on for water, waterborne diseases pose severe health risks. Many Haitians live on less than two U.S. dollars a day, making it difficult for them to afford food or water services even when they are available. Contaminated water is a primary vector for diseases such as cholera and diarrhea, which can be fatal without proper treatment. The lack of access to clean water also hinders proper hygiene practices.

 That’s where Lily Hospital, INC, and groups of colleagues come in to build a proper water system in Bourg-Patriot, Haiti. Your support can help provide clean, safe drinking water and improve the health and well-being of the community. Please consider contributing to this crucial initiative.
